Problem

Existing temperature measurement devices face challenges in accurately and quickly measuring temperatures of objects, especially batteries, while minimizing electricity flow and contact pressure, particularly when there is a large distance between the object and the temperature-sensitive section.

Innovation Solution

A temperature measuring device comprising an electrical temperature measuring instrument with a heat transfer part made of elastomer, embedding the temperature-sensitive section, and a heat insulation part covering one side of the heat transfer part, which has higher thermal conductivity than the insulation part, allowing efficient heat transfer while reducing electrical contact and contact pressure.

If the temperature sensitive section is placed close to the object for temperature measurement, then measurement accuracy and speed improve, but electrical contact and contact pressure increase

The patent introduces an elastomeric material as an intermediary between the temperature sensitive section and the object being measured. This elastomer serves multiple functions: it provides thermal conduction path for accurate temperature measurement, while simultaneously providing electrical insulation to prevent short circuits, and its elastic properties reduce contact pressure on the measured object.

If heat insulation is applied to the heat transfer part, then heat dissipation is reduced improving measurement accuracy, but thermal conduction to the temperature sensitive section is also reduced

The patent applies heat insulation selectively to specific regions of the elastomeric heat transfer part. The heat insulation layer is applied to the outer surface of the elastomer, creating a structure where the inner region maintains high thermal conductivity for rapid heat transfer to the temperature sensitive section, while the outer insulated region prevents heat loss to the environment, thus improving measurement accuracy without compromising response speed.

Function Achieved in This Case

Enables accurate and rapid temperature measurement with reduced electricity flow and minimal contact pressure, as demonstrated by improved performance compared to comparative examples, with a temperature difference of about 2 degrees Celsius and measurement delay of 30 seconds in steady state.

PatentUS11480473B2Temperature measuring device and temperature measuring arrangement
Publication Date: 2022.10.25 NOK CORP

A temperature measuring device includes an electrical temperature measuring instrument configured to measure the temperature of a temperature sensitive section electrically; a heat transfer part formed of an elastomer in which the temperature sensitive section is embedded; and a heat insulation part formed of an elastomer covering a single surface of the heat transfer part. The heat transfer part has a thermal conductivity that is greater than a thermal conductivity of the heat insulation part. A mounting section is formed at the heat insulation part, and is to be mounted at a mounting location.
